Frequently Asked Questions
What are the height and setback rules for a Marana fence?
Zoning limits are 3 feet front, 6 feet rear. Setbacks are 0-foot for side/rear lines. A 0-foot front setback is only allowed if the fence does not obstruct the required visibility 'sight triangle' at corners, especially critical for lots near I-10.
What is the utility locate process for a fence in Continental Reserve?
You must call Arizona 811 at least two working days before digging. Hitting a line creates major liability and repair costs. Our crew files the locate ticket and manages all associated permit paperwork with the town to prevent delays.
Am I legally required to notify my neighbors before building a fence in Marana?
Yes. Arizona Revised Statutes 9-461.15 requires written notice to adjoining property owners for any fence built on a shared boundary line. This 2026 'good neighbor' law applies before you obtain a permit from the Marana Municipal Complex.

Do modern pool gates need smart technology to meet code?
Not required, but smart-gate IoT latches that self-report status are becoming standard. They help ensure continuous compliance with Marana Town Code Chapter 15-4, which mandates ASTM F1908-08 self-closing, self-latching mechanisms.
Why do fence posts in Continental Reserve require deep concrete footings?
Footings must extend below the 12-inch frost line to prevent frost heave. In Marana's soil, posts set in shallow concrete will lift from freeze-thaw cycles, violating IRC 2018 and ASCE 7-22 standards for structural stability.
What fencing materials are best for Marana's soil and pest conditions?
Use termite-resistant materials like steel or composite. For steel, specify G90 galvanized or powder-coated fasteners to combat moderate soil corrosivity. Inferior fasteners cause rust streaks on stucco within 18 months.
How does Marana's 105 MPH V-ult wind speed affect fence design?
The 105 MPH V-ult rating dictates engineering. Standard 8-foot post spacing often fails. Designs require closer spacing, concrete-filled steel posts, and wind-rated brackets to survive peak monsoon gusts, per ASCE 7-22 calculations.
